Finding the Rhythms of Life

The more time I spend with the Lord, the more I get to know His nature. And the more I know His true nature, the more I want to spend time with Him. What a blessed cycle! 

As I quiet down in His presence, my trust in Him builds as I experience the peace He provides when I rest in Him. In Matthew 11 in the Message Jesus says, “Walk with me and work with me—watch how I do it. Learn the unforced rhythms of grace.” 

As you hear this parable by Wayne Mueller describing how the kingdom of God works much like a seed, hear Jesus calling you to slow down and take a longer view of yourself as we move in the natural rhythms He provides. 

“We can work without stopping, faster and faster, electric lights making artificial day so the whole machine can labor without ceasing. But remember: no living thing lives like that. There are greater rhythms that govern how life grows....seasons and sunsets and great movements of seas and stars...We are part of the creation story, subject to the laws and rhythms. 

“To surrender to the rhythms of seasons and flowerings and dormancies is to savor the secret of life itself. 

“Many scientists believe we are ‘hard-wired’ like this, to live in rhythmic awareness, to be in and then step out, to be engrossed and then detached, to work and then to rest...It is a reminder of how things are, the rhythmic dance to which we unavoidably belong.” Wayne Mueller 

When I can make myself slow down, I can get in touch with the rhythms of life instead of doggedly trudging on to satisfy the accomplish-monster inside of me. That has become the work of my salvation and perhaps yours too. David said that there is a time for everything under the heavens. When I surrender to the rhythms of life, I can learn to rest when that season presents itself. I am one of those people who has to work at resting. But I am trying.
